Norwich City forward Mathias Kvistgaarden will be out injured for six weeks.
The Dane limped off with a knee problem at Coventry during the Canaries' most recent Championship game.
Defender Ben Chrisene will miss eight weeks with a hamstring injury sustained in the same match.
Head coach Liam Manning has been speaking to the media before Saturday's game at home to Wrexham - here are some of the key points:
Both Kvistgaarden and Chrisene do not require surgery to aid their recoveries from injury.
Manning said he is not worried about his side's failure to win at home yet, but admits it is important the team put that right as soon as possible.
